Rancho Texas Park

Rancho Texas Park

A truly unique park in the heart of Puerto Del Carmen, Rancho Texas is not only an animal park, it is a water park and Wild West adventure park all rolled into one. It is the perfect choice for families looking for a fun day out in Lanzarote.

Play real life Cowboys and Indians

When you enter the park you will pass through the Native American territory with grand Teepees and medicine caves that you can play inside. The teepees are lined alongside the Indian lagoon where you can even try a kayak ride if you wish. Why not search for gold in the interactive gold mine, ride a pony around the river or watch the famous Cowboy as he performs some exciting cowboy tricks?

The Animals

This is the biggest zoo in Lanzarote and there are surprises waiting around every turn. Some of our favourites have to be the amazing white tigers and the gorgeous penguins as well as the funny looking armadillos.  

There is a farm area with ponies, donkeys, bunnies and goats. This area is often a favourite with young children as they can pet some of the animals here. There is also an impressive Reptile Area where you will find the likes of snakes, huge turtles and scary crocodiles too. 

The Shows

There are several shows performed throughout the day so we recommend that you check the timings when you enter the park so you don’t miss out. 

The Birds Of Prey show

Make sure you duck down as these incredible birds swoop right above your heads. Their wing spans are amazing!

The Dolphin Show

Watch as the dolphins, jump, dance and play with balls to music as they entertain the crowds. There is even chance to interact with the dolphins and have your photograph taken with them too. (We recommend booking this in advance and it’s good to know that children from as young as 3 years old can enjoy the experience too).

The Sea Lion Show

These are the funniest creatures in the park. They love to play and entertain and they will certainly put a smile on your face. It is also possible to organise photographs and interactions with the sea lions for that extra special treat. 

The Parrot Show

These clever parrots and cockatoos will mesmerise you as they perform numerous tricks as they entertain the crowds. 

The park also offers you the chance to cool down a little with its new fun and exciting Splash Park. It is only small but it is a welcomed extra feature on a hot, summer’s day.  Don’t forget your swimwear and towels as this area includes a children’s splash zone with water jets, mini slides and a cascading water bucket. There are also two bigger slides. One is 100 metres long while the other is 82 metres long. They wind through the volcanic scenery into a plunge pool at the bottom. (These bigger slides do have a small height and age restriction). There is a sunbathing terrace, parasols and changing room with lockers close by too.

Food and Drink Options

There are two main food options inside the park. One is a snack bar beside the splash park and the other is the fast food area inside the main building. They are reasonably priced for attraction park standards. 

Travel 4 Baby’s top tips

  •       There are buggy parking areas beside the main show and also inside the fast food zone
  •       Baby changing facilities can be found in the toilets by the entrance, by the pool bar area and by the fast food area in the ladies room in the main restaurant.
  •       There are parking areas if you have a hire car. If you are staying in the Playa Del Carmen or Costa Teguise area, taxis are a cheap, fast option.
  •        The park offers a bus service from Playa Blanca, Costa Teguise and Puerto Del Carmen. Double check timings and availability directly with the park.
  •       Try to get to the park early so you don’t miss any of the shows. You can always leave earlier then if you don’t want to eat in the park. You can’t officially take food inside however, water, baby’s bottles and a few kids snacks will be fine.
  •        Make sure you wear comfy shoes and lots of sun cream and if you are going in the splash zone remember the water may be cold so take something warm to wrap up in afterwards.
  •        Take a little spending money for souvenirs. Also, the pony rides and Kayak rides cost a couple of euros extra.
